#homepage, #preambule, #doc, #doc #hd {width:405px;margin:5px auto}
.controller-panier #homepage,
.controller-panier #preambule,
.controller-panier #doc,
.controller-panier #doc #hd {width:640px}
.controller-articles #homepage,
.controller-articles #preambule,
.controller-articles #doc,
.controller-articles #doc #hd {width:535px}

#preambule .left {width:100px;float:left;padding-left:10px}
#preambule .right {width:100px;float:right;padding-right:10px}

#doc #bd {width:395px;padding:5px}
.controller-panier #doc #bd {width:630px}
.controller-articles #doc #bd {width:525px}

#homepage #hd h1 a {top:25px}
#doc #hd h1 a {margin-left:5px}

#doc #navigation {margin-left:5px;width:300px;margin-top:0}
.brand-eboutic #doc #nav {height:25px;margin-top:-5px;padding-top:10px;margin-bottom:-5px;padding-bottom:5px}
#link_panier {margin:0;width:100px;}
#link_panier a {margin:0}
#link_panier img {display:none}

#parrainage, #extra, #extra_noel, #extra_noel_ruban {display:none}

.bigpicture, .decoration, .salelogo {display:none;}

.side {margin:100px 20px 0;float:none;width:280px}
.brand-femina .side {margin-top:150px}

#homepage .cta {margin-bottom:2em}

#ft .left {width:100%;text-align:center;margin-bottom:10px}
#ft .right {width:100%;text-align:center;font-size:10px}

.js .signup .bd p label {position:static;color:#fff;width:45%;float:left;text-align:right;padding:.3em 0;display:block}
.js .signup .bd p input.text {width:50%;float:right;font-size:85%;padding:.2em 0}

.brand-eboutic #homepage .register {padding:0 11px;margin:0;background:transparent}

.left, .right,
.bigleft, .bigright,
.smallleft, .smallright {float:none;width:100%;margin:0}

#sales_now, #sales_future {margin-left:0}

.listingsales li {width:395px}

.listingproducts li {margin-left:5px;margin-right:5px}

#produit, #produitimg, #produitinfo {border:0 none;width:100%}
#more {width:95%}

.wizard a,
.wizard span {width:150px}

#navigation a {margin-right:.8em}
